How to rotate the middle row seats of Refine?

1 Answers
Correia
07/29/25 6:58pm
The middle row seats of Refine can be rotated. There are three adjustment handles beside the seats. Lift the bottom handle and rotate the seat to complete the operation. What is the Principle of Tire Pressure Sensors?

Tire pressure sensors primarily operate based on the following two principles: 1. Direct Tire Pressure Monitoring: This method uses pressure sensors installed in each tire to directly measure the air pressure. A wireless transmitter then sends the pressure data from inside the tire to a central receiver module, which displays the pressure readings for each tire. 2. Indirect Tire Pressure Monitoring: When the pressure in a tire decreases, the vehicle's weight causes the rolling radius of that tire to become smaller, resulting in a faster rotation speed compared to the other wheels. By comparing the differences in rotation speeds among the tires, the system monitors the tire pressure. Indirect tire pressure warning systems essentially rely on calculating the rolling radius of the tires to monitor air pressure.

What are the symptoms of a faulty car air conditioning compressor?

The symptoms of a faulty compressor are as follows: 1. Compressor seizure - The compressor fails to rotate. The cause is poor lubrication or lack of lubrication. For instance, if the refrigeration oil leaks due to refrigerant leakage, or if the oil overflow pipe of the evaporator, the oil overflow valve of the POA valve, or the oil hole of the oil-gas separator (accumulator) in the CCOT system is blocked, the compressor may seize due to insufficient refrigeration oil. 2. Compressor leakage - There are two scenarios: oil leakage and gas leakage. In minor cases, only refrigerant leaks; in severe cases, both refrigerant and refrigeration oil leak. There is also slight leakage at the shaft seal. If the annual leakage is less than 14.2g, it does not affect the refrigeration system's performance and is considered normal. If the leakage exceeds 14.2g, maintenance is required, including replacing the seals. If the compressor's cylinder block cracks and causes leakage, the compressor should be replaced. 3. Poor compressor operation - A manifold pressure gauge can be used to measure the compressor's suction and discharge pressures. If both pressures are the same and the compressor feels abnormally hot when touched, the cause may be cylinder gasket blow-by. High-pressure gas from the discharge valve leaks back into the suction chamber through gaps in the cylinder gasket, gets compressed again, and produces even hotter vapor. This cycle can carbonize the refrigeration oil, rendering the compressor useless. If the intake or discharge valve springs are damaged or weakened, the compressor may fail to compress the refrigerant or compress poorly. In this case, the suction and discharge pressures may be the same or similar, but the compressor will not overheat.

How to Use the Key to Raise and Lower the Windows on the Envision?

Specific usage method: Short press: The window will automatically lower all the way; Short pull: The window will automatically rise all the way; Long press: Release during the window's descent to stop it; Long pull: Release during the window's ascent to stop it. Below is relevant information: 1. One-touch window operation: One-touch window operation refers to a system where the car window glass can be controlled to raise or lower into position with a single button press. Cars equipped with one-touch window operation have two-stage window control switches. The first button position functions like a regular power window. The second position allows the window to automatically fully open or close with a single press and release. 2. Precautions: When the window encounters an obstacle (such as a hand or head) during ascent, it can automatically reverse to the bottom to prevent accidents. Many anti-pinch windows use Hall sensors to determine the glass position. If an obstacle blocks the glass during ascent, the power window immediately stops rising and lowers all the way to achieve anti-pinch functionality.

Do I need to sign for confirmation if I fail Subject 2?

Theoretically, whether you pass or fail the Subject 2 exam, you need to sign the score sheet for confirmation (electronic score sheets can also be signed). However, in practice, it usually doesn't matter even if you don't sign, as the score will still be recorded and uploaded. Just to be safe, it's best to sign and confirm your score after each exam. Signing the score sheet doesn't mean you've passed the exam. Theoretically, you need to collect the score sheet and sign it regardless of whether you pass or fail. In practice, many candidates who know they've failed don't collect the score sheet to sign but leave the exam site directly. The score sheet records the candidate's exam results, so checking your score will let you know whether you've passed. If you fail the Subject 2 exam on the first attempt, you can retake it once. If you don't take the retest or still fail the retest, the exam ends, and the applicant should reschedule the exam after ten days. Within the validity period of the driving skill test permit, the number of scheduled exams for Subject 2 and Subject 3 road driving skills tests must not exceed five. If you still fail the fifth scheduled exam, the results of other subjects you've passed will be invalidated.
